Operating Income
Operating income is the amount of profit realized from a business's core operations, excluding taxes and interest expenses.
Negative Net Cash Flow
A situation where a company's outgoing cash exceeds the incoming cash during a specific period, indicating potential financial trouble.
Financial Statements
Structured reports that detail the financial performance of an organization, typically including the balance sheet, income statement, and cash flow statement.
Depreciation Expenses
The allocation of the cost of tangible assets over their useful lives, recognized as an expense on the income statement.
